Answer:the adjustment to record bad debts for the period will require a
Debit on
Bad debt expenses for $ 12,670 and a credit To Allowance for doubtful accounts for $ 12,670
Explanation:
Account receivables for uncollectibles= $13,900
Allowance for Doubtful Accounts = credit balance of $1230
Adjusting entry for bad debts expense =Account receivables - credit balance of $1230
= $13,900- $1,230
=$12,670
Adjusting entry for the record of bad debts expense
Accounts titles Debit Credit
Bad debt expenses $ 12,670
To Allowance for doubtful accounts $ 12,670

Answer:
Debit Cash account $6,500
Credit Deferred revenue $6,500
Explanation:
When cash is collected in advance for a service yet to be rendered, the revenue for that service will be deferred in recognition.
The company will recognize an asset in form of cash and a liability in form of deferred revenue.
Hence to record the transaction,
Debit Cash account $6,500
Credit Deferred revenue $6,500
Being entries to recognize cash collected for service yet to be rendered.
Answer: Current Asset
Explanation:
Accounts receivable is defined as money owed to the company by its customers for goods or services rendered that is to say When a company provides goods or render services to another customer or company but is awaiting payment on a short term basis, then the company documents the accounts receivable on a balance sheet as a current asset.
it is recorded as current asset because under legal obligations, the company will receive cash in due time,usually within a year that is why companies who render credit based goods and services set payment terms and conditions to monitor and ensure payment because this affects the company liquidity.
